What is Online Charging System (OCS)?
The OCS stands for the online rating for Service Providers e.g. Telecom Operators who would like to rate online voice, SMS, USSD, data and other services. Service Providers: MNO, MVNO, IoT can offer PrePaid, cost control and manage fraud risk. As the telecom services are growing at fast pace, the business model of the operator has slowly shifted from communications-centric to service-centric. Due to the fact operators have shifted to the new charging system that supports different charging modes such as content-based charging and volume-based charging. With new online charging system, CSP provides users with real-time control of chargeable services.
OCS is communication tool which can be utilized by Service Provider to charge a user for providing services in real-time. The OCS handles subscribers account balance, rating, billing deal control, and correlation. A telecom operator ensures that credit limits are enforced and resources are authorized on a per deal basis with all the OCS. Previously the traditional offline charging system only used to collect charging information CDRs after a service is rendered and couldn’t prevent the huge revenue loss caused by service overdraft. Online charging capabilities provided by Intelligent Network (IN), is very popular in telecom industry but features poor market adaptability. The traditional online charging systems charge the customer after an ongoing solution is rendered, whereas the OCS charges as services are rendered. OCS is more versatile than smart Network (IN) solutions.
Due to some technical limitations, the old IN system cannot provide the same perks to prepaid users as enjoyed by postpaid users. As from longtime prepaid users demanded of the same services, the new online charging system was formulated. OCS system provides users with greater pricing flexibility.
